The main new area for the school
was the introduction of teaching Kiteboarding. We
quickly gained recognition as a BKSA and IKO recognised
school one of only a handful in the country. This
new venture has proved very popular and we feel is
essential to teach this fantastic sport safely so
that students can become safe kiteboarders. During
the last year Steph has been competing on the national
kiteboarding circuit and has achieved several top
3 results including a second place at the last round
of the series at Camber sands in Kent. Steph is looking
forward to the coming season where we are sure she
will compete at the very highest level.
This year
we are still tentatively maintaining our normal operating
base however the land is now subject to planning
permission from the developers. We hope that we will
be able to stay throughout the summer however we
have alternative plans locally should we have to
move which should not impact too much on operations.
At present we are seeking permission to site a floating
pontoon up river to base the sailing activities from.
If we are successful in this it will provide a perfect
base to manage the sailing from. Onshore we continue
to have constructive talks with East Devon District
council and we feel closer to securing a purpose
built onshore facility than ever before.

Powerboat
course bookings held up well last year with many
people being introduced to safe powerboat techniques.
As each year passes and the Exe gets ever busier
with Ribs and Ski boats flying around all over the
place it becomes even clearer that powerboat training
becomes ever more important. We run the basic 2-day
learn to powerboat
course that is ideal for complete
beginners to become confident. The main changes this
year are too introduce use of the GPS as part of
the basic navigation. There is also the introduction
of a youth powerboat scheme, ideal for the under
16’s to learn the basics. For those
that achieve the level 2 they can then get an ICC
allowing powerboat use abroad.
